Objectives:

1. Provide university engineering students in Mongolia with a comprehensive understanding of memory principles tailored to their academic and professional needs within the field of engineering.
2. Explore memory enhancement techniques optimized for engineering-related information retention and recall, including mathematical concepts, scientific principles, and technical terminology.
3. Develop proficiency in advanced memory systems such as the method of loci and the peg system, customized for memorizing engineering formulas, diagrams, and complex problem-solving strategies.
4. Learn strategies for effective encoding and retrieval of engineering information across various disciplines, from mechanical and electrical engineering to civil and computer engineering.
5. Enhance cognitive skills such as attention, concentration, and spatial reasoning to improve memory encoding and recall processes critical for success in engineering studies and careers.
6. Practice memory exercises and drills specifically designed to strengthen memory capacity, speed, and accuracy within the context of engineering-related information and scenarios.
7. Identify individual learning preferences and styles to tailor memory techniques for personalized effectiveness in engineering studies and professional endeavors.
8. Address common memory challenges faced by university engineering students, such as memorizing complex formulas, diagrams, and technical specifications, and offer effective coping strategies.
9. Explore the impact of lifestyle factors, such as time management and stress management, on memory function in the context of engineering education and careers.
10. Apply memory techniques to practical engineering tasks, including problem-solving exercises, design projects, and data analysis, within the framework of a two-day workshop.
11. Foster metacognitive awareness of memory strengths and weaknesses to monitor and adjust memory strategies effectively throughout the intensive program.
12. Create personalized memory improvement plans integrating a variety of techniques and strategies to achieve long-term memory mastery and success in engineering studies and careers.
13. Provide opportunities for hands-on application of memory techniques through engineering simulations, design challenges, and real-world case studies relevant to the students’ academic and professional interests.
14. Engage students in reflective exercises and self-assessments to evaluate progress and identify areas for further improvement in memory skills specifically targeted for engineering-related information and tasks.
15. Foster a supportive and collaborative learning environment where students can share insights, experiences, and best practices to enhance memory mastery collectively within the context of engineering education and careers.
16. Empower students with the knowledge, skills, and confidence to leverage their enhanced memory capabilities for academic achievement, professional success, and lifelong learning in the dynamic and innovative field of engineering.
